If you own a beauty kit, do not store a ton of makeup in it. You want to have a decent amount, but not too much makeup with you. Consider your needs for day and evening applications. Unused makeup can undergo unpleasant chemical changes once opened if left for extended periods of time. Worse, this makeup that has been sitting around may be harboring germs, so don’t use any makeup that has been unused for months.

Do not wear large flower shapes or floral patterns if you are trying to give off a smaller size look. These big shapes are unflattering. Focus instead on small patterns and prints to take the attention away from your overall size.

Become aware of your body’s weaknesses and strengths. Fitted clothing can help to accentuate a smaller person’s best features. Large chests will be best paired with patterned bottoms. Women with pear-shaped figures should wear light clothing on top and darker clothing on bottom.

If regular travel is a part of your work schedule, make sure you have several easy to wear, wrinkle free items in your wardrobe. Although many hotel rooms have ironing boards, you shouldn’t waste time ironing when you don’t have to. Save yourself some time by unpacking and hanging all items upon your arrival at the hotel.
